We came here with our college-aged daughter and had a really enjoyable evening. The atmosphere is…read morelively, with an EDM soundtrack that gives the restaurant a fun, club-like vibe. We never felt rushed and had plenty of time to look over the menu before ordering. We started with the Steak Tartare, served with beer-battered smoked onion petals, truffle, egg yolk, and manchego. It was excellent and one of the highlights of the meal. We also tried the Za'atar Roasted Local Vegetables with spicy greens, feta tzatziki, lime pickles, and pepitas. It was good, but it wasn't my favorite dish. For our entrées, one person ordered the Rigatoni Bolognese with pork and beef ragu, housemade raw milk ricotta, and Parmigiano-Reggiano. It was rich, comforting, and absolutely delicious. We also ordered the Jerk Local Swordfish from Fort Lauderdale with braised Swiss chard, local radish escovitch, and jackfruit miso beurre blanc. While the swordfish itself was cooked well, I wasn't a fan of the jerk seasoning. The flounder, however, was outstanding and probably my favorite entrée. To drink, I had the Les Fumées Blanches Orange Sauvignon Blanc, which I really enjoyed. Someone else had an Old Fashioned. For dessert, we shared the Affogato with mascarpone ice cream, dark chocolate, and espresso, and it was a perfect ending to the meal. The service was attentive without being overbearing, and we appreciated being able to enjoy our meal at a relaxed pace. It is on the pricey side, but that's fairly typical for a farm-to-table restaurant using quality ingredients. There's a small parking lot behind the restaurant, and we were lucky enough to grab a spot. Overall, it's a fun place for a date night or a nice dinner with family. I'd definitely recommend giving it a try. Or if you want, they have a great bar and you can hang out there and have a bite.

I only review nachos…read more At a rock bar. For $10.95. And honestly? Not bad. The chili is the real deal -- well seasoned, properly cooked, carries the whole plate. The cheese sauce works with it instead of fighting it. The scallions actually added something, which in South Florida is rarer than you'd think. And they served the sour cream and pico on the SIDE, which is smarter than most restaurants twice the price have figured out. The Fork Rule was violated. But when you put chili and cheese sauce on chips without layering, physics wins every time. That's fixable. Layer it, add more chips, and this nacho moves up significantly. At $10.95 after a good night out with the music loud and a cold beer in hand? These nachos are exactly what you need. Not trying to be anything they're not. 6 out of 10. Worth it for the price and the vibe. Florida Nacho Man will be back. -Florida Nacho Man
